2968. yaab
Lexicon
yaab: To desire, to long for

Original Word: יָאַב
Part of Speech: Verb
Transliteration: ya'ab
Pronunciation: yah-av'
Phonetic Spelling: (yaw-ab')
KJV: long
NASB: longed
Word Origin: [a primitive root]

1. to desire

Strong's Exhaustive Concordance
long

A primitive root; to desire -- long.

NAS Exhaustive Concordance
Word Origin
a prim. root
Definition
to long, desire
NASB Translation
longed (1).

Brown-Driver-Briggs
[יָאַב] verb long, desire (Aramaic , and especially Ethpa`al and derivatives) —

Qal Perfect1singular לְמִצְוֺתֶיךָ יָ˜א֑בְתִּי Psalm 119:131, late Aramaism.

Englishman's Concordance
Psalm 119:131
HEB: כִּ֖י לְמִצְוֹתֶ֣יךָ יָאָֽבְתִּי׃
NAS: and panted, For I longed for Your commandments.
KJV: and panted: for I longed for thy commandments.
INT: for your commandments longed
